    Using Work Offsets (G54-G59)

    Can someone tell me how to how to utilize work offsets in Mastercam x4. I'm assuming its something simple I'm overlooking... Thanks

    you have to go into the configuration and add the view manager button to the toolbar. You can create new veiws and use them to create new offsets. You have to make sure you have the view plane and the construction plane set the same for example top and top. You can change them in the planes tab in the toolpath dialogue box for the toolpath your trying to give a different work offset.
